Plants and Animal Adaptations

TUNDRA Animals grow thick fur which turns white in the winter. Plants in the tundra are small and grow close to the ground. These are how the animals and plants adapt to the cold climate of the tundra.
TAIGA
The plants in the Taiga grow in dense patches to survive. The animals in the Taiga are like the animals in the Tundra. They need warm fur to keep warm.
